Angus Taylor has inadvertently taken centre stage in an Icac hearing – and the fallout could be profound

If the opposition leader was funding one side of a vicious factional war, it would be hard for many in the party to stomach

Independent Commission against Corruption inquiries have an uncanny tendency to sprawl in unexpected directions.

Just ask former New South Wales premier, Gladys Berejiklian, who was caught on tape with her secret boyfriend, former NSW MP Daryl Maguire, during an investigation into his dealings with developers. Or former premier Barry O’Farrell, who was tripped up over a bottle of Penfolds Grange during an inquiry into state water contracts.
